POSITION INFORMATION

Our technicians are responsible for providing superb customer service by diagnosing, visual inspections, removal of parts and attachments, warranty repairs, performing preventative maintenance services, repairing lights and wiring, welding, cutting and other repairs.

This position reports to the Mobile Service Manager, is a 40 hour a week position and is eligible for overtime. For well-qualified, proven efficient applicants, we also offer a flat rate compensation plan. This position also qualifies for a monthly bonus incentive based on your upsales.

To qualify for a mobile technician position, you must have a high school diploma or equivalent. You must have three years of diesel truck service and computer diagnostics experience. Mechanical aptitude and technical ability are required. You must be able to operate power and hand tools and other equipment safely. You must be able to read and comprehend instructions and information, possess a valid driver's license, and have a driving record that meets our criteria. You will be required to obtain and maintain a DOT Driver Medical certification. Dressing professionally and being able to communicate well orally and in writing with customers, vendors, and other contacts is a must.

The technician position is a physically demanding position. You will stand six to eight hours per shift. Will stoop, kneel, crouch, crawl, reach, handle and feel. Will use hand and power tools. Will lift parts weighing up to 70 pounds several times during each shift. Will use hoist and test equipment. Will be exposed to noise, vibration, dust, exhaust fumes, and other hazardous and nonhazardous materials.
